Javascript Help
Javascript is a very common form of client side (it works in your web browser rather than on the web server) code. The majority of web users have javascript switched on.
If you do not have javascript switched on in your browser, you will be unable to use some of the rich content in modern websites. For example, Google maps or any website using Ajax technology.

How to Switch Javascript On or Off
Internet Explorer 7
1. From the Main Menu, select Tools > Internet Options
2. Click the Security tab
3. Click the Custom Level button
4. Scroll down to Scripting, near the bottom of the list.
5. Under Active Scripting, choose Enable.
6. Click OK to leave Security Settings
Click OK to 'Are you sure you want to change the settings for this zone?'
Click OK to leave Internet Options.
Firefox
1. Tools > Options
2. Select the Content tab
3. Check/Uncheck 'Enable Javascript' as required.
